public IActionResult EvidentirajKuhara(string KorisnikID, int KuharID = 0) { KuharEvidentirajVM kuhar = new KuharEvidentirajVM(); kuhar.KorisnikID = KorisnikID; var RolaId = _dbContext.Korisnici.Find(KorisnikID).RolaID; if (KuharID == 0) { kuhar = new KuharEvidentirajVM(); } else { kuhar = _dbContext.Kuhari .Where(x => x.KuharID == KuharID) .Select(y => new KuharEvidentirajVM { KuharID = y.KuharID, ImeKuhara = y.ImeKuhara, PrezimeKuhara = y.PrezimeKuhara, PlataKuhara = y.PlataKuhara }).SingleOrDefault(); } kuhar.KorisnikID = KorisnikID; kuhar.KuharID = KuharID; kuhar.RolaId = RolaId; return(View(kuhar)); }
public void EditKuhara(KuharEvidentirajVM vm) { var kuhar = _context.Kuhari.Find(vm.KuharID); kuhar.ImeKuhara = vm.ImeKuhara; kuhar.PrezimeKuhara = vm.PrezimeKuhara; kuhar.PlataKuhara = vm.PlataKuhara; _context.SaveChanges(); }
public void DodajKuhara(KuharEvidentirajVM vm) { Kuhar kuhar = new Kuhar() { ImeKuhara = vm.ImeKuhara, PrezimeKuhara = vm.PrezimeKuhara, PlataKuhara = vm.PlataKuhara }; _context.Add(kuhar); _context.SaveChanges(); }
public IActionResult Snimi(KuharEvidentirajVM x) { Kuhar kuhar = new Kuhar(); if (x.KuharID == 0) { _dbContext.Add(kuhar); } else { kuhar = _dbContext.Kuhari.Find(x.KuharID); } kuhar.KuharID = x.KuharID; kuhar.ImeKuhara = x.ImeKuhara; kuhar.PrezimeKuhara = x.PrezimeKuhara; kuhar.PlataKuhara = x.PlataKuhara; _dbContext.SaveChanges(); return(Redirect("PrikazKuhara?KorisnikID=" + x.KorisnikID)); }
public IActionResult EditKuhara(KuharEvidentirajVM vm) { _kuharInterface.EditKuhara(vm); return(Ok()); }
public IActionResult DodajNovog(KuharEvidentirajVM vm) { _kuharInterface.DodajKuhara(vm); return(Ok()); }